Biography
So, our today's hero is Christoph Schneider. His biography began in 1966. It was then that on May 11, in East Germany, a Berlin district called Pankov, the future musician was born. Mother was a music teacher, father - director of the Berlin Opera. The family had two children. Constance is the sister of our hero, 2 years younger than him (at the beginning of Rammstein's creative activity, she and her brother sewed costumes for a group that was almost unknown at that time). Parents sent their son to a music school. Thus began his fascination with this art form. At a music school, he was offered a choice of trombone, clarinet and trumpet. Christophe Schneider chose the last instrument. However, he was fascinated by the game of drummers. As a result, he took up the development of drumming. He mastered this art on his own. At first I used a home-made installation. It was made of buckets and cans. Later, at the age of 14, the young man acquired the first installation.
After that, parents, who were supporters of classical music and who had previously resisted the transition of their son to drums, practically approved his passion and calmed down. Christophe began his activities in various courtyard groups. There he performed with friends. The young man tried to learn professional drumming, but failed the entrance exam. He coped with the drums, but the musical notation, singing and piano failed him. As a result, not having mastered the proper education, our hero learned to play the drums on his own. He was guided by his favorite music. In 1984, Schneider became the only member of Rammstein, who went to serve in the army. Returning home, he became an employee of a telecommunications company. After was a handyman. For two years he was a loader at a mountain weather station. He returned to the music. How the drummer played in groups: Feeling B, Frechheit, Keine Ahnung. Together with Richard Kruspe he worked in the Die Firma team. At this time, the musician met with Christian Lorenz and Paul Landers - future colleagues at Rammstein.

Musical preferences
Christoph Schneider prefers to listen: Meshuggah, Motorhead, Ministry, Dimmu Borgir, Led Zeppelin, Deep Purple. He, as a drummer, was particularly influenced by Phil Rudd, an AC / DC drummer. Our hero prefers heavy music, but listens to absolutely everything that he considers interesting at a certain point in time, for example, Madonna or Coldplay. In addition, Nicole Scherzinger loves. He is fond of the work of this singer. In his performances he uses the following equipment: microphones, pedals, drum sticks Vic Firth SCS, drum kit Sonor, cymbals Meinl and Sabian.

Discography
Christoph Schneider has contributed to many of Rammstein's studio albums, in particular Herzeleid's debut album. It was released in 1995. The album cover shows the band members standing against a huge flower. The musicians were waist-deep without clothes. Critics accused the collective of attempting to demonstrate themselves as a "dominant race." The album was later released in a different cover.
The songs Rammstein and Heirate Mich are in David Lynch's Highway to Nowhere. All compositions from this record were performed live. The songs Das alte Leid and Der Meister mainly played in the first round of the band. Other compositions were also performed during subsequent tours. On a tour called Made in Germany, they played Asche zu Asche, Wollt ihr das Bett in Flammen sehen and Du riechst so gut. Not included in the album songs Biest and Jeder Lacht.
